Requirements and responsibilities
As a key member of the application development team, this individual will be responsible for leading the technical development and support for internal web applications supporting our Rating business.
What you’ll do
- Design and develop scalable user-facing features using modern frontend technologies like React, and JavaScript;
- Ensure responsive design and cross-browser compatibility;
- Optimize application frontend for performance;
- Integrate backend services with the UI layer;
- Design and develop RestFul APIs and microservices that support frontend functionalities;
- Create server-side logic using languages such as Java;
- Manage databases (PostgreSQL, Oracle) and write efficient queries;
- Implement security and data protection measures;
- Proficiency in DevOps tools such as Azure DevOps;
- Work closely with other stakeholders and participate in Sprint ceremonies to ensure the alignment with Agile methodologies.
What you’ll bring
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or equivalent;
- 5+ years of hands-on Java development experience. Experienced working with JMS, executor framework, and design patterns;
- 2+ years of experience in UI development using React, JQuery, JavaScript, HTML5 & CSS;
- Hands-on experience in Spring and Hibernate;
- Experience working with RESTful APIs;
- Hands-on experience on Oracle or SQL Server database;
- Hands-on experience in SQL queries and writing stored procedures;
- Experience working in Unix/Linux Operating System;
- Experience working with Weblogic/Apache Tomcat;
- Technical proficiency in software build tools like Maven and Continuous Integration tools like Jenkins/Hudson;
- Experience working with source code control systems such as Git;
- Experienced in agile development methodology;
- Strong analytical skills;
- Any experience in building applications for the financial industry is a plus.
